I used to have a 6line in my 180g. No issues. Now I have one in my frag tank. Night 1 (yesterday) I found him down in the pvc stand/leg under lighting diffuser. I though he was stuck, body bent in half. I lifted the rack and his body kinda fell out and looked lifeless.

Alive and well next morning.

Day 2, (just now) I found him behind overflow box on top of poly fill mesh. Just enough water to cover dorsal fin. Ugh.

I even supplied 2 pvc pipes laying down for him to sleep in yesterday.


Anyone else have weird stories like this?
 
Not sure on the sleeping behavior of 6 lines, but if they are anything like fairy wrasses they can do some weird things in their sleep. I had a Red Head Salon Fairy Wrasse that would sleep in a rock cave looking like it was lying dead on it's size. Each morning he would come out fine though.
 
I’ve seen some 6 lines sleep in sand, and others entirely wedged inside the rock. They’re kinda goofy.

I used to have a small clown who would sleep sideways on top of a gyre pump at night. He probably only had a 1/4 inch of water over him. The first couple times I saw him there, I thought he was stuck somehow, but nope. Just a weirdo.
